Method
Preparation
- Preheat your oven to 350°F (175°C) and line baking sheets with parchment paper.
- In a bowl, whisk together the flour, baking soda, and salt. Set aside.
- In another large bowl, cream together the softened butter, brown sugar, and granulated sugar until smooth.
- Beat in the eggs one at a time, stirring in the vanilla extract and a few drops of blue food coloring (if you're feeling fun!).
- Gradually mix in the dry ingredients until just combined.
- Fold in the white chocolate chips, dark chocolate chips, crushed Oreos, and crushed chocolate chip cookies.
Baking
- Drop spoonfuls of dough onto the prepared baking sheets.
- Bake for 10-12 minutes, or until the edges are lightly golden.
- Allow to cool on the baking sheets for a few minutes before transferring to wire racks to cool completely.
Notes
For a chewier texture, chill the dough for about 30 minutes before baking. Store cookies at room temperature for a week or freeze for up to three months.
